**Handover — ProctorPipe queue**

Hey, taking off for the week, so here's the state of ProctorPipe. The exam intake queue has been stable since we bumped worker counts Tuesday, but watch for the Thursday-morning spike when the Calderwood exam block starts — it's triple normal load. If consumers stall, restart the intake workers one at a time; restarting all at once drops in-flight sessions and angers everyone. The queue workers currently run with these configuration values.

settings of yageg-yahap:
[gorael]
team = olieth
access_code = ac_941d74
owner = brieth.aldiel
host = gorael.tolvaqio.internal
port = 6379
peer = briwyn.urlaqtech.internal
salt = 116e6622
pin = 1957

Changelog 4.12.0 — Deduplicated customer records in the Tarnwick directory service. Merge logic now keys on normalized name plus account lineage instead of raw email hash, reducing duplicate rate from 3.1% to 0.2% in staging. Tombstones are written for merged records so downstream syncs stay consistent. Reviewers: focus on the merge-conflict resolution in the reconciler module. The author responsible for this change is listed below.

approver of bagug-bagag = Holael Pramir

14:22 — Confirmed the Quillbase report builder switched to an unstable sort in the ranking pass, reordering rows with equal keys between runs. No data exposure; output integrity only. Fix reverted the comparator to the stable merge path. Verified against the regression suite on the Harwick staging cluster. The patched build is identified by the token recorded below.

session token of hawif-yagep = htk14_cdc8f861ea8d22